Plans & Reports

The Workforce Innovation and Opportunity Act (WIOA) requires local workforce development boards and chief elected officials to engage in an integrated regional and local workforce planning process to prepare, submit, and obtain approval of a single collaborative regional plan as well as a local plan for each workforce region. These plans serve as a four-year action plan to develop, align, and integrate service delivery strategies to support the stateโ€™s and local elected officialโ€™s vision, strategic and operational goals.
